Proper Equipment and Techniques

Professional mold remediation companies have access to specialized equipment and techniques that are not available to the average homeowner. This equipment includes high-powered HEPA vacuums, air scrubbers, and negative air machines. These tools are necessary for properly removing mold and ensuring that the air is free of mold spores.

Containment and Protection

During the mold remediation process, it’s essential to contain the mold to prevent it from spreading to other areas of the home. Professional mold remediation companies use containment measures such as plastic sheeting and negative air pressure to prevent the spread of mold spores. They also wear protective gear such as gloves, masks, and goggles to protect themselves from exposure to mold.

Hiring a Mold Remediation Company

When hiring a mold remediation company, it’s important to do your research and choose a reputable and experienced company. Look for a company that is licensed, insured, and certified by organizations such as the Institute of Inspection Cleaning and Restoration Certification (IICRC). Ask for references and read reviews from previous clients.

The mold remediation process typically involves the following steps:

Inspection: A professional mold remediation company will conduct a thorough inspection of your home to identify the source and extent of the mold growth.
Containment: The moldy area will be contained to prevent the spread of mold spores.
Removal: The mold will be physically removed using specialized equipment and techniques.
Cleaning: The affected area will be cleaned using antimicrobial solutions to prevent future mold growth.
Restoration: Any damaged materials will be repaired or replaced, and the underlying cause of the mold growth will be addressed.
